Difficulties with Paper-Based Documentation

How many times have you found yourself buried under piles of paperwork that never seem to end? If you're like most people, the answer is probably way too many times. Traditional paperwork can be really tiring. It entails printing documents, signing them physically, mailing them to recipients, collecting signatures, and managing them, resulting in a slow and inefficient process that reduces productivity.

Benefits of Digital Signatures

The solution to the difficulties of traditional paperwork is to switch to digital signatures. By using digital signatures, you can swiftly streamline this entire process and handle all of your documents in a centralized and easily accessible digital system. Many businesses around the world have begun to embrace digital signatures as they provide faster turnaround time, cost-effectiveness, and great ease by simplifying the procedure from beginning to end. Furthermore, shifting from physical papers to digital agreements is environmentally friendly and reduces paper waste.

Digital signatures often known as electronic signatures or a contemporary alternative to traditional handwritten signatures. Digital signatures are reliable, provide enhanced security, and can't be easily tampered with like handwritten signatures. They use digital signature certificates that have the signer's identity linked to them, making them more secure. Digital signatures allow signers to attach a digital fingerprint to a document, which works as a seal, and if the signed document is posed or tampered with, the document becomes invalid. Digital signatures are also legally binding and have the same legal status as handwritten signatures in most countries. Moreover, digital signatures are more convenient for everyone involved. Signers can use their smartphone or computer to sign agreements from anywhere at any time, making the process much more flexible and accessible.

Zoho Sign: A Digital Signature Software

Zoho Sign is a digital signature software that could make your life so much easier. With Zoho Sign, you can securely sign and send documents through a cloud-based platform. Not only that, but businesses worldwide have been able to save money by digitizing their documentation process with Zoho Sign. The best part is Zoho Sign offers advanced features such as templates, sign forms, bulk signing, and in-person signing, making your work more streamlined. If you need more customization, Zoho Sign is built with REST APIs that allow you to integrate it with various other applications. You can also use these APIs, web groups, and SDKs to build custom integrations.

Zoho Sign serves as a flexible solution that caters to signatories across industries, including sales, human resources, finance, IT operations, legal, marketing, support, product management, entertainment and media, real estate, NGOs, and numerous others. Regardless of your industry, you can always rely on Zoho's stringent data privacy and security requirements, such as the GDPR, CCPA, and HIPAA, ensuring that your sensitive information is always protected. Zoho Sign also uses multi-factor authentication, access reports, tamper-proof audit trials, and digital certificates to ensure data integrity. Zoho Sign allows signers to be authenticated by sending one-time passwords through email or SMS or by requiring the attachment of supporting documents to confirm their identity. Adding to that, Zoho Sign utilizes blockchain-based timestamping and trusted document timestamping to provide proof of existence and track any modifications or instances of forgery. Zoho Sign also integrates with regional trust service providers to provide qualified electronic signatures, along with eID in the European Union, Swisscom Trust Services in Switzerland, and EU esign via Aadhar and E-mudra e-KYC in India, Sign with SingPass in Singapore, and advanced electronic signatures with Trust Factory in South Africa. Zoho Sign complies with the majority of regional and international e-sign legislation, including PIPEDA in Canada, the E-Sign Act and UETA in the United States, the eIDAS in the European Union, the Information Technology Act of 2000 in India, and the Electronic Transaction Act in Australia and other Southeast Asian countries.

Zoho Sign is a user-friendly solution that is available on a variety of platforms. The app is accessible on any device through a web browser or as native applications for Android, iOS, iPadOS, macOS, and Windows. It is synchronized across all your devices, providing for a smooth transition between platforms. This feature gives you the ultimate flexibility to work from any device at any time, assuring maximum productivity. Zoho Sign is one of the most tightly integrated apps in the Zoho ecosystem, integrating with over 15 commonly used Zoho apps. Not only that, but it also connects with prominent third-party ecosystems and applications such as Microsoft 365, Google Workspace, Zapier, HubSpot, and Dropbox. With this level of integration, Zoho Sign makes it simple to streamline your workflow and manage all of your tasks from a single location.

Zoho Forms: A Powerful Online Form Builder

Online forms are electronic documents used to gather information from individuals or organizations. These forms are developed and accessible through the internet. Online forms can be designed to collect a variety of information, such as customer feedback, event registrations, job applications, and much more. They offer a more efficient and convenient way to collect data and are quickly replacing traditional paper-based forms. Online forms are used in a wide range of industries, including healthcare, education, government, finance, and retail. They are used to gather client feedback, handle orders, register for events, collect job applications, and more.

Zoho Forms is a powerful online form builder and data collection tool that helps businesses streamline their data management processes. With Zoho Forms, you can easily create and distribute forms tailored to your specific needs, with over 30 field types, customizable themes to match your branding, and situation-specific templates. Zoho Forms enables you to design and share forms with ease. Zoho Forms offers advanced features such as creating merge templates, setting up notification alerts, and connecting forms to other business tools to automate your workflows based on the data collected through forms to save time and effort. With the Zoho Forms mobile app, you can collect data on the go, available for both iOS and Android. The app allows you to collect data even when you're offline. It also allows you to use your phone's camera to effortlessly scan barcodes for data autofill and directly add images to your forms.

Integrating Zoho Sign and Zoho Forms

To integrate Zoho Sign and Zoho Forms, you need a valid Zoho Form subscription and a valid Zoho Sign subscription at the professional edition or higher. Each submission that includes automation features, such as sending the document signing link via email or redirecting the visitor to the document for signing upon form submission, will use either an automation credit or Zoho Sign credits, depending on your Zoho Sign subscription plan. The enterprise plan provides automation credits each month proportionate to the number of license users. However, if your organization runs out of automation credits, subsequent submissions will consume those credits, which can be purchased as add-ons.

To integrate Zoho Sign and Zoho Forms, first, create a Zoho Sign template for your document and customize it with the necessary fields. Next, create a Zoho form for collecting document data. Then, integrate the Zoho form with the Zoho Sign template by mapping the recipient fields on the template with the corresponding form fields. Fetch the recipients' names and email addresses from the form fields. Choose an action to be performed upon form submission or save the configuration to complete the integration. Finally, send the document for signing to the recipients you wish to collect signatures from by selecting their form entries.

Sharing and Embedding Zoho Forms

To share your Zoho form as a public link, select the public option under share with, then simply copy the link provided under form permalink URL and share it with your audience. You can disable the public link using the toggle in the top right corner. Another option is to share the form as a QR code. This allows your audience to directly access the form on their devices. You can also share the form on your social networks, such as Facebook, Twitter, and LinkedIn, directly from Zoho Forms. Zoho Forms also provides you with options to share your forms with specific users in your organization, groups, and all users of your organization. To embed the form, select embed and choose your preferred embedding option. Then, Zoho Forms will generate a code for you to use, which you can then embed on your web page.

Using Zoho Sign and Zoho Forms Integration

To use Zoho Sign and Zoho Forms integration, the applicant will receive an email with a digital signature request after submitting the form. If you had chosen the sender documents linked to recipient's email option while integrating, they should click start signing in the received email. Upon clicking start signing, they will be redirected to Zoho Sign. If you had chosen redirect to Zoho signed document as your preferred action upon form submission, the applicant would directly land on this page after submitting the form. Here, they must review the details on screen and click proceed to document. Next, they must carefully review the terms and conditions and click agree and continue to proceed further. Then, they should fill in all the required sign-up information, such as their name, or whatever they have been asked to fill. Finally, they should click finish to complete the signing process. After completing the signing process, they will have the option to download a copy of the signed document for their records.

To manually send documents for signature using the Zoho Sign and Zoho Forms integration, go to the Zoho Forms dashboard and navigate to the forms or report section. Now click on all entries below the corresponding form or report that you want to work with. Once you have identified the entries that you want to send documents for signing, select their check boxes. Next, click on the send for sign button. Finally, a pop-up will appear asking for your confirmation to proceed with sending the document for signature. Simply click to proceed, and now you have successfully sent the document for signature.

Creating Reports in Zoho Forms

To create reports in Zoho Forms, access the reports tab from the Zoho Forms dashboard or select reports under your preferred form. When you access reports from a form, you will be taken to the report section of that specific form, where you will find a list of all reports created for the form. When you access reports directly from the dashboard, you will be taken to the reports page, where a list of all reports you have created till date will be displayed. From the reports page, you can manage, edit, and generate new reports for your forms. To create a new report, click on the new report button located in the top right corner of the page. Next, name your report and select the form for which you want to create the report and click on create. Your new report will now be available for you to customize.
